Securing Your BMS: Best Practices for Digital Safety
Protecting your property's Management System (BMS) is vitally important in today's networked landscape. Enforcing robust safeguards measures is not optional. Start by frequently updating firmware and software to address known vulnerabilities. Limit access by implementing check here strong authentication and two-factor verification . Additionally, isolate your infrastructure to block rogue access and establish clear response plans to manage any breaches . Finally, undertake periodic security reviews to uncover and fix any weaknesses before they can be leveraged by attackers and malicious actors.

Beyond Passwords: Advanced BMS Cybersecurity Strategies
The reliance on standard passwords for Building Management System (BMS) defense is ever more insufficient in today's sophisticated threat landscape. New BMS cybersecurity approaches must move far outside this basic layer. A reliable defense demands a comprehensive plan, encompassing multiple critical elements. These include utilizing multi-factor approval, periodically conducting security assessments, and proactively tracking network data. Furthermore, isolating the BMS infrastructure from corporate IT systems is essential to prevent lateral movement following a compromise. Finally, ongoing staff education on threat prevention best procedures is paramount to lessen the threat of user error.
